Central African Republic suffers food shortages as rebels cut off capital
by Kaamil Ahmed from World news | The Guardian on (#5D941)
State of emergency declared after armed opposition forces attack convoy carrying supplies and blockade the city of Bangui
Central African Republic is facing serious food shortages as election violence has cut off the country and stranded hundreds of trucks carrying supplies outside its borders.
Food prices have risen steeply since the landlocked country's main supply route from Cameroon was cut off by armed groups trying to blockade the capital, Bangui, where the government declared a state of emergency on Thursday.
